How Much Does International Travel Insurance Cost?

Cost depends on your age, trip length, destination, and coverage level. Here's a realistic guide for Singaporean travelers:

Traveler AgeMedical Only (per day)With Trip Cancellation
Under 40$2–$4/day4–5% of trip cost
40–59$3–$7/day5–6% of trip cost
60–69$6–$13/day7–8% of trip cost
70–79$11–$22/day8–10% of trip cost
80+$20–$45/dayLimited options

Example: A healthy 42-year-old Singaporean traveler on a 14-day trip would pay roughly $50–$100 for medical-only coverage, or $180–$350 for a comprehensive plan on a $3,500 trip.

⚠️ Your Singapore Health Coverage Won't Help You Abroad

Singapore's MediShield Life and Integrated Shield Plans (Great Eastern, Prudential, AIA, NTUC Income) are designed for treatment in Singapore hospitals only. Overseas medical costs — particularly in the US, UK, or Australia — require either an international health plan or standalone travel insurance with emergency medical coverage. A single US hospital stay can easily exceed SGD 50,000.

📋 Schengen Visa Requirement

For a Schengen visa, Singaporean travelers must show travel insurance with at least €30,000 in emergency medical coverage valid for the entire Schengen zone. Singaporeans enjoy visa-free access to most Schengen countries (Singaporean passport is among the world's most powerful), but travel insurance is still a Schengen entry requirement.

Does international travel insurance cover pre-existing conditions for Singaporean travelers?

Some plans cover pre-existing conditions — specifically for "acute onset" (a sudden, unexpected flare-up of a stable pre-existing condition). IMG Patriot International offers acute onset coverage on select tiers. If you have a serious pre-existing condition, disclose it fully when applying and select a plan that explicitly includes this benefit. Tower Hill's quote tool will show you which plans offer pre-existing condition benefits for your profile.

When should Singaporean travelers buy international travel insurance?

Buy as soon as you make your first trip deposit — ideally within 14 days. This timing unlocks pre-existing condition coverage and Cancel For Any Reason (CFAR) upgrades that are not available if you wait. There is no price penalty for buying early — the policy simply activates on your departure date. Many Singaporean travelers mistakenly assume they can purchase insurance the day before departure; you can, but you will miss important protections.

What happens if I have a medical emergency abroad and need to go to a hospital?

Call the 24/7 emergency assistance number printed on your insurance card immediately. Your insurer's emergency team can identify approved hospitals near you, communicate with local providers in their language, pre-authorize treatment to minimize upfront payment, and coordinate medical evacuation back to Singapore if your condition requires it. Do not wait until after treatment to notify your insurer — pre-authorization typically speeds up the claims process and reduces the amount you may need to pay out of pocket.
